Output e3587fe181471db8f203abdde3062697be57d3650a13a3a89087df452d8e699e:0

value
1096577
script pubkey
OP_0 OP_PUSHBYTES_20 dd05c0a6951a0f7f3a40e4f7ffb9bd73ee2248b5
address
bc1qm5zupf54rg8h7wjqunmllwdaw0hzyj94wxgllw
transaction
e3587fe181471db8f203abdde3062697be57d3650a13a3a89087df452d8e699e
spent
true